Quick Summary

The Department of the Army, through the 174th Attack Wing, USPFO Activity NYANG, is soliciting proposals for the construction of an MQ-9 Static Display Concrete Pad at Hancock Field Air National Guard Base, Syracuse, NY. This Total Small Business Set-Aside opportunity has an estimated magnitude between $25,000 and $100,000. Award will be based on Lowest Price. Offers are due April 21, 2026, at 02:00 PM EST.

Scope of Work

The project requires the construction of a fully functional static display concrete pad and pillars for an MQ-9 aircraft, meeting industry and DoD standards. Key tasks include:

  • Excavation, demolition, and removal of existing materials.
  • Placement of a 68-foot diameter, 4-inch thick reinforced concrete slab with a single layer of 6x6 W2.9/W2.9 Welded Wire Fabric (WWF).
  • Construction of five concrete piers (minimum 4000 PSI).
  • Installation of relief cuts (1.5 inches deep, spaced 2-3 times depth in feet) and sealant application on the concrete slab.
  • Contractor is responsible for engaging and paying a third-party lab for concrete compression testing.
  • Restoration of disturbed surfaces to their original condition.
  • Note: The Government (MXS) will handle drilling, anchoring, and the erection/placement of the static display; the contractor is not responsible for this scope.

Logistics & Requirements

  • The Molloy Road Gate is the designated haul route, with a maximum overhead clearance of 17'-2 1/2". Escorts are required for concrete trucks and equipment.
  • Water for concrete curing and dust control is available approximately 250 LF from the project site at Building 174; no additional backflow prevention is needed if using this source.
  • All work must comply with applicable state and federal laws, DoD policies, Unified Facilities Criteria (UFC), and New York State Code.
